from redis.commands.search.field import TagField、TextField、VectorField ModuleNotFoundError:没有名为“redis.commands”的模块错误

问题描述 投票:0回答:1

从 redis.commands.search.field 导入 TagField、TextField、VectorField ModuleNotFoundError:没有名为“redis.commands”的模块

我有以上内容 - 并且正在使用 redis 3.5.3 我该如何重述这个?

python redis
1个回答
0
投票

使用 redis.commands 至少需要 redis=5.0.8。但是,如果您将使用 redisearch 查询数据库,则会与依赖的 redis 版本冲突。所以请自行承担更新风险🤷🏻u200d♂️

© www.soinside.com 2019 - 2024. All rights reserved.